Web   ·   Wiki   ·   Activities   ·   Blog   ·   Lists   ·   Chat   ·   Meeting   ·   Bugs   ·   Git   ·   Translate   ·   Archive   ·   People   ·   Donate
summaryrefslogtreecommitdiffstats
path: root/iconcombobox.py
diff options
context:
space:
mode:
Diffstat (limited to 'iconcombobox.py')
-rw-r--r--iconcombobox.py8
1 files changed, 5 insertions, 3 deletions
diff --git a/iconcombobox.py b/iconcombobox.py
index 077fa7a..18d7f82 100644
--- a/iconcombobox.py
+++ b/iconcombobox.py
@@ -24,10 +24,11 @@ from gi.repository import Gtk
from sugar3.graphics.combobox import ComboBox
from sugar3.graphics import style
-
class IconComboBox(Gtk.ToolItem):
- def __init__(self, icon_name, **kwargs):
- Gtk.ToolItem.__init__(self, **kwargs)
+
+ def __init__(self, icon_name):
+
+ Gtk.ToolItem.__init__(self)
self.icon_name = icon_name
self.set_border_width(style.DEFAULT_PADDING)
@@ -39,4 +40,5 @@ class IconComboBox(Gtk.ToolItem):
self.add(self.combo)
def append_item(self, i, text):
+
self.combo.append_item(i, text, icon_name=self.icon_name)